Evaluation of sampling gear for demersal resource surveys
The three demersal trawls evaluated were 38 m HSDT-II, indigenously developed
by CIFT for deep sea fishing in Indian EEZ; and two imported designs, viz.,
45.6 m Expo model demersal trawl and 50 m fish trawl operated from vessels of FSI
and IFP, respectively. Vertical opening at trawl mouth was heighest for 50 m fish
trawl (3.2 m), followed by Expo model demersal trawl (2.5 m) and 38 m HSDT-II
(2.2 m), due to differences in overall dimensions and design features. Estimate of
horizontal opening between otter boards was highest for 38 m HSDT-II probably due
to low drag of the gear, followed by 45.6 m and 50 m trawls. Lowest catch per unit
effort obtained by 38 m HSDT-II is presumably due to smaller dimensions of the gear,
larger codend mesh size and difference in ground rig, in addition to chance factors.
However, 38 m HSDT-II scores on several features desirable in demersal sampling
gear such as simplicity in design and construction, ease of operation; lower twine
surface area and drag; and ground rig suitable for wider range of bottom conditions.
Modifications to make it more effective while sampling for crustaceans and small sized
finfish components are described
Ultrasonic intensification as a tool for enhanced microbial biofuel yields
peer-reviewedUltrasonication has recently received attention as a novel bioprocessing tool for process intensification in many areas
of downstream processing. Ultrasonic intensification (periodic ultrasonic treatment during the fermentation process)
can result in a more effective homogenization of biomass and faster energy and mass transfer to biomass over short
time periods which can result in enhanced microbial growth. Ultrasonic intensification can allow the rapid selective
extraction of specific biomass components and can enhance product yields which can be of economic benefit. This
review focuses on the role of ultrasonication in the extraction and yield enhancement of compounds from various
microbial sources, specifically algal and cyanobacterial biomass with a focus on the production of biofuels. The
operating principles associated with the process of ultrasonication and the influence of various operating conditions
including ultrasonic frequency, power intensity, ultrasonic duration, reactor designs and kinetics applied for ultrasonic
intensification are also described

Effect of Castor oil as Biolubricant on Tribological Characteristics of EN31 Steel Experimentation and Validation
The main aim of this study to investigate the effect of castor oil blended with lube oil (SAE20W40), on Tribological characteristics of bearing material (EN31), using Ball on Disk Tribotester. The disc test material was EN31 Steel, 165 mm diameter and Test ball material was EN31 Steel, 10 mm Diameter. The test was performed at temperature of 45oC with different loads and different rotating speeds(Test duration of 3600 sec.).The test was conducted in wet conditions using the ASTM G99 Wear and Friction test procedure. Experiments were conducted based on the plan of experiments generated through Taguchi's technique. A L16 Orthogonal array was selected for analysis of data. The petroleum based lubricant used for this experiment was SAE 20W40 and contaminated with a various blends like 0% 10%, 20%, 30% of castor oil. The lubricant is characterized by viscosity using viscometer. From the experimental result, it is found that the wear is increased with increase in loads, increased in speed and sliding distance. The overall result of this experiment reveals that the wear for various blending percentage were different, moreover the wear for 10% castor oil blending were almost identical with base lubricant. This blend can be used as lubricant for piston pump application, which is environmental friendly in nature and would help to reduce use of petroleum based lubricants substantially.</jats:p

Nanotechnology and Biomedical Applications of Nanotechnology
Solid colloidal particles of size from 10 to 1000 Nanometre are known as Nanoparticles. Nanoparticles contribute many benefits to bigger particles such as enhanced surface-to-volume ratio and enhanced magnetic properties. Over the last few years, there has been an undeviating growing interest in using nanoparticles in different biomedical applications such as targeted drug delivery, hyperthermia, photo ablation therapy, bio imaging, and biosensors. Iron oxide nanoparticles have dominated applications, such as drug delivery, hyperthermia, bio imaging, cell labelling, and gene delivery, because of their superior properties such as chemical stability, non-toxicity, biocompatibility, high saturation magnetization, and high magnetic susceptibility. In this paper, biomedical applications of two different types of nanoparticles metal oxide nanoparticles and carbon nanotubes are discussed.</jats:p
Analysis of Factor’s Causing Delays in Road Project by Severity Index Method
The construction sector is one of the important sources of growth and development of the national economy. However, entirely projects background delays in construction work and therefore raise its time and money. Problem in structure/construction work is studied one of the important obstacles in the work and it has a very large issue in terms of time, money, and quality. This survey is done to find the time achievement of the road development project to identify the causes of delays and related factors according to the contractor with the help of the Questionnaire Survey which was taken with the help of Google Forms. As per the research, there are a total of 32 factors affecting the delay/ failure of the road. As per the survey accidents during construction, an increase in material price, change in cost, and delay in time are the top factors which mostly affect the road failure. These factors were analyzed with the help of the Severity Index Method and mathematically with the help of Excel and Google Forms and then the result was calculated.</jats:p
